jonbwfc wrote:
Amnesia10 wrote:
Well I looked around and decided to get a 64Gb black iPhone. Opted to get it through Three on the One Plan. By doing it through a cash back site the upfront cost of £109 will be reduced to under £7. Even with the higher repayments which really offset the full cost of the phone and I get loads more minutes than I would get on a simple PAYG deal and for not much more over a two year deal.

So how much did you end up paying per month?

£42 per month on the One plan, 2000 any network minutes plus additional 5000 minutes to Three users and unlimited web and 5000 texts not that I ever use more than 5 a month.

A buy from Apple and install cheapest GiffGaff deal would cost £699 +£240 for (250 minutes per month) calls over 24 months totalling £939

Three's deal was £109 plus £1008 (24 months at £42) for (2000 minutes per month) calls/data etc, though the cash back (£102.50) will reduce that total to £1016. So the difference is £77 more over the two years which is only £3.21 per month for all the extra calls and I can tether my iPad as well.
